When selling your Ocala home, a thorough electrical inspection is essential. It ensures buyer confidence and helps identify any potential issues before they become costly problems. To make the inspection process efficient, follow this checklist:
- Make certain all light fixtures, outlets, and switches are functioning correctly.
- Examine wiring for any signs of damage, including fraying or exposed wires.
- Test the electrical panel for proper grounding and labeling.
- Think about upgrading outdated electrical systems to meet safety regulations.
- Record any repairs or upgrades lately by a licensed electrician.
By following these tips, you can get ready your Ocala home for a successful electrical inspection and increase the likelihood of a quick and profitable sale.
